Novavax, Inc. is a clinical stage biotechnology company. The Company creates novel vaccines to address a broad range of infectious diseases worldwide using proprietary virus-like particle (VLP) technology.

Its products are widely used in vehicle service and repair, as well as in other demanding industrial environments. The company is best known for its premium tool brand, often sold through a network of franchised mobile stores, and is a primary supplier to technicians in the transportation industry.
